U.S. Army Soldiers with 2nd Armor Brigade Combat Team, 1st Infantry Division, receive training on using the Inoculate Operating System on their tablets from medical workers at the Fair Park Community Vaccination Center in Dallas, Feb. 22, 2021. Inoculate is an online system used to track patient medical information concerning their vaccinations. U.S. Northern Command, through U.S. Army North, remains committed to providing continued, flexible Department of Defense support to the Federal Emergency Management Agency as part of the whole-of-government response to COVID-19.
